U.S. Marines with Combat Logistics Battalion 22, Combat Logistics Regiment 27, 2nd Marine Logistics Group, execute sprints on assault bikes as part of a physical training session during a 2nd MLG Human Performance Center 12-week training program on Camp Lejeune, North Carolina, Oct. 2, 2024. The HPC’s 12-week program consists of initial baseline assessments, surveys, and in-briefs with the remaining weeks spent on physical training sessions and classes to help Marines and Sailors of CLB-22 improve in all domains of Marine Corps Total Fitness.
